Customers have reported Hoha.shop for operating a scam that involves a fake store. The site’s inventory consists of knock-off products, which could pose safety risks due to the substandard materials used in their manufacture. Notably, the website’s content appears to be a clear imitation of other similar sites, hinting at a lack of originality. At the point of discovery, the website was barely a month old, just 26 days to be precise.

Notably absent is a customer service phone number, leaving customers without a direct line of contact. The images used on the site fail to provide a true representation of the products being sold, further damaging the site’s credibility. The website also contains multiple incomplete pages, filled with generic content and placeholder text.

Adding to the list of red flags, the company’s social media presence is practically non-existent which is unusual in today’s digital age. Each of these factors contributes to the conclusion that Hoha.shop is running a fraudulent operation, and consumers are advised to exercise caution when dealing with this website.

Fake store scams are deceptive operations where a fraudulent online shop is set up to trick customers into buying non-existent or substandard products. These sites often mimic the look and feel of legitimate stores, but their inventory is usually comprised of inferior quality or counterfeit goods. They typically lack customer service options and may have incomplete or poorly constructed web pages.

A fake store scam is a fraudulent scheme where scammers create a fake online store. These stores often sell popular products at very attractive prices. But once you make a purchase, they either send you a cheap counterfeit or nothing at all. The scammers make these websites look real by using logos of popular brands. They may use fake customer testimonials and reviews to gain your trust. Often, they'll even have a customer service number or email that goes unanswered. It's important to do your research before shopping online. Look for secure payment methods, read the store's policies, and check for reviews on independent sites. If a deal seems too good to be true, it probably is. Don't let them fool you, always stay safe while shopping online.
